Absolutely you can get the certificate for any year Porsche. Just call 1-800-PORSCHE and have your credit card ready. You get a small discount if you are a member of PCA. I know they used to ask for proof of ownership of the car but not sure if they do that now for older cars where they might not have the current owner's name on file.
